Nona Biosciences, a global biotechnology company providing integrated solutions from "Idea to IND" (I to ITM), ranging from target validation and antibody discovery through preclinical research, announced a research collaboration with Atossa Therapeutics Inc. (Nasdaq: ATOS). The collaboration leverages Nona's proprietary H2L2 Harbour Mice® platform to identify next-generation therapeutic candidates for breast cancer.
Nona Biosciences' proprietary Harbour Mice® platform employs transgenic mice to generate fully human monoclonal antibodies in both the conventional two heavy and two light chain (H2L2) format and the heavy chain-only (HCAb) format, eliminating the need for additional engineering or humanization. Combined with the single B cell cloning technology, this platform offers a powerful approach to developing therapeutic antibodies and accelerating drug discovery and development. To date, Harbour Mice® platform has been applied in more than 250 drug discovery programs across multiple therapeutic areas and has been widely recognized by global partners.
